本文提供了Laravel Live Templates在PhpStorm中的使用指南。用户需首先打开首选项,随后按顺序选择“工具”、“设置”、“存储库”,并添加相关的Live Templates以提升开发效率。
Laravel, PhpStorm, Live Templates, 使用指南, 首选项设置
在开始使用 Laravel Live Templates 提升开发效率之前,了解如何正确地在 PhpStorm 中进行设置至关重要。PhpStorm 是一款专为 PHP 开发者设计的强大集成开发环境(IDE),它提供了丰富的功能来简化开发流程。对于 Laravel 开发者而言,利用好 PhpStorm 的设置功能可以极大地提高工作效率。
PhpStorm
> 偏好设置
。文件
> 设置
。编辑器
> Live Templates
。Live Templates
设置页面中,点击右上角的 +
图标以添加一个新的模板。laravel.blade
,用于 Blade 模板引擎。Abbreviation
字段中输入简写,如 lar
,以便快速插入模板。Template text
区域编写模板内容。例如,对于一个简单的 Blade 模板,可以输入:
<div>
@foreach($items as $item)
{{ $item }}
@endforeach
</div>
$items
定义为变量:
<div>
@foreach(${items} as $item)
{{ $item }}
@endforeach
</div>
${}
表示该变量是可编辑的。在实际使用时,会提示用户输入具体的值。lar
并按下 Tab
键,即可看到模板被自动插入。$items
,并按 Tab
键确认。通过以上步骤,开发者可以轻松地在 PhpStorm 中安装和配置 Laravel Live Templates,从而显著提高编码速度和减少重复工作。这些模板不仅有助于保持代码的一致性,还能帮助团队成员更快地熟悉项目结构。
lar
)并按下 Tab
键,即可快速插入预设的模板。$items
被定义为变量时,用户可以根据实际情况输入具体的数组或集合。Tab
键确认每个变量的值,直到所有变量都被替换。通过掌握 Live Templates 的基本和高级使用技巧,开发者能够在 Laravel 项目中更加高效地编写代码,同时保证代码质量和一致性。这不仅有助于提高个人生产力,还能促进团队间的协作和沟通。
${variableName}
的形式定义。如果问题仍然存在,尝试重启 PhpStorm 或清除缓存。Live Templates
设置页面中找到对应的模板,对其进行编辑并保存更改。Live Templates
设置页面中,选中不需要的模板,点击右上角的 -
图标即可删除。if
语句)来处理不同情况下的代码生成,使得模板更加灵活多变。通过不断地优化和调整 Live Templates,开发者可以进一步提高编码效率,减少重复劳动,同时确保代码的一致性和规范性。这对于长期维护和扩展项目来说是非常有益的。
本文详细介绍了如何在 PhpStorm 中使用 Laravel Live Templates 来提高开发效率。从打开首选项到设置 Live Templates,再到具体的使用指南和高级技巧,开发者可以轻松掌握这一强大工具的使用方法。通过自定义模板、优化模板内容以及共享模板等方式,不仅能够显著提升编码速度,还能确保代码的一致性和规范性。此外,文中还列举了一些常见的问题及其解决方法,帮助开发者在遇到挑战时能够迅速找到解决方案。总之,合理利用 Live Templates 可以为 Laravel 项目带来极大的便利,无论是对于个人开发者还是团队协作都有着重要的意义。